Establishment and characterization of an iPSC line from a 35 years old high grade patient with nonalcoholic fatty liver disease (30-40% steatosis) with homozygous wildtype PNPLA3 genotype.
Stem Cell Research(2018)
摘要
Nonalc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D) is the hepatic manifestation of the metabolic syndrome and its prevalence increases continuously. Here, we reprogrammed fibroblasts of a high grade NAFLD patient with homozygous wildtype PNPLA3 genotype. The induced pluripotent stem cells (iPSCs) were characterized by immunocytochemistry, flow cytometry, embryoid body formation, pluritest, DNA-fingerprinting and karyotype analysis.
